Biography of Jacqueline Kennedy
Jacqueline Kennedy Onassis, born Jacqueline Lee Bouvier on July 28, 1929, in Southampton, New York, was an American socialite, writer, and the First Lady of the United States from 1961 to 1963. Her grace and intelligence made her one of the most admired figures of her time. Despite the challenges she faced, Jacqueline remained resilient and dedicated to her family and public service throughout her life.
Personal Details and Bio Data
Full Name | Jacqueline Lee Bouvier Kennedy Onassis |
---|---|
Date of Birth | July 28, 1929 |
Place of Birth | Southampton, New York, USA |
Date of Death | May 19, 1994 |
Place of Death | New York City, New York, USA |
Cause of Death | Non-Hodgkin's Lymphoma |
Occupation | First Lady, Editor, Socialite |
What Were the Early Years of Jacqueline Kennedy Like?
Jacqueline Lee Bouvier grew up in a privileged yet complex environment. Her parents, John Vernou Bouvier III and Janet Norton Lee, divorced when she was young, leaving a lasting impact on her. Despite this, Jacqueline excelled in academics and extracurricular activities, showing early signs of the poise and intelligence that would later define her public persona.
How Did Jacqueline Kennedy Become a Cultural Icon?
Jacqueline Kennedy's role as First Lady brought her into the global spotlight. Her impeccable fashion sense, commitment to historic preservation, and efforts to promote the arts made her a beloved figure. She transformed the White House into a cultural hub and became a symbol of elegance and sophistication.

Life After the White House
Following the assassination of President John F. Kennedy, Jacqueline's life took a dramatic turn. She married Greek shipping magnate Aristotle Onassis in 1968, seeking refuge from the constant scrutiny of the public eye. Later, she worked as a book editor in New York, carving out a new identity for herself while maintaining her privacy.
What Was Jacqueline Kennedy Diagnosed With?
In 1993, Jacqueline Kennedy was diagnosed with Non-Hodgkin's lymphoma, a type of cancer that affects the lymphatic system. This diagnosis marked the beginning of her final battle with illness, during which she displayed remarkable courage and resilience.
The Final Days of Jacqueline Kennedy
As Jacqueline's health deteriorated, she chose to spend her final days surrounded by family and close friends. Her strength and grace during this difficult time touched the hearts of many, reaffirming her legacy as an enduring symbol of resilience.
Jacqueline Kennedy Death Cause Unveiled
The official cause of Jacqueline Kennedy's death was complications from Non-Hodgkin's lymphoma. Despite undergoing treatment, the cancer had progressed to an advanced stage, leaving her body unable to recover. Her passing on May 19, 1994, marked the end of an era, but her legacy continues to inspire generations.
Did Jacqueline Kennedy Receive Treatment for Her Illness?
Yes, Jacqueline Kennedy underwent chemotherapy and other treatments for Non-Hodgkin's lymphoma. However, the disease proved to be aggressive, and despite the best efforts of her medical team, her condition worsened over time.

Frequently Asked Questions About Jacqueline Kennedy Death Cause
- What type of cancer did Jacqueline Kennedy have? Jacqueline was diagnosed with Non-Hodgkin's lymphoma.
- When did Jacqueline Kennedy pass away? She passed away on May 19, 1994.
- Where did Jacqueline Kennedy spend her final days? Jacqueline spent her final days at her New York City apartment, surrounded by loved ones.
Interesting Facts About Jacqueline Kennedy
- Jacqueline Kennedy was fluent in French and Spanish.
- She was an accomplished equestrian in her youth.
- Jacqueline was instrumental in the restoration of the White House and promoting its historical significance.
